Flooding can have devastating results on communities, ecosystems, and infrastructure. Among these results, the influence of flooding on property worth is especially significant and concerning for owners and investors alike. When a property is affected by floodwaters, the immediate aftermath can lead to a fast devaluation in its worth.
Homebuyers are inclined to weigh the potential dangers associated with buying properties in flood-prone areas. This hesitation can lead to decreased demand, thereby driving property values even decrease. Typically, properties located in areas designated as flood zones are seen as much less desirable as a end result of heightened dangers, and this perception can linger lengthy after the waters have receded.


Insurance prices also contribute substantially to the impression of flooding on property worth. Homeowners in areas known for flooding usually discover themselves going through skyrocketing premiums or difficulty securing flood insurance in any respect. These financial burdens make properties less engaging to potential buyers, additional diminishing their value.


The long-term impacts on property values could be exacerbated by antagonistic financial situations. If a community suffers a catastrophic flooding event, not solely does it impression individual property costs, but it can additionally result in a wider economic downturn in the space. Businesses may shut, unemployment would possibly rise, and the general financial vitality of the neighborhood can suffer—all of which contribute to reduced property values.

Local governments additionally play a crucial function in figuring out how flooding impacts property values (Storm Damage Cleanup Kellerman AL). In the wake of a disaster, municipalities often invest sources into rebuilding and enhancing infrastructure. While these initiatives might finally stabilize property values, the short-term fallout can still be quite severe.


Properties that have experienced flooding can even carry a stigma that impacts their marketability. The recollections of previous flooding events can deter buyers, leading to extended intervals in the marketplace and further price reductions. Even if homeowners have made repairs and enhancements, patrons should harbor concerns about future flooding.


The potential for future flooding events also complicates the difficulty. Predictions about local weather change and increased rainfall patterns suggest that areas previously thought-about secure may not be so. This uncertainty creates a ripple effect, causing potential buyers to assume twice. Consequently, properties in flood-prone areas may even see significant declines of their valuations.




Investment dynamics can shift in areas experiencing recurrent flooding. As threat components turn out to be extra obvious, investors might turn their focus in direction of extra secure regions, leaving the property market in flooded areas stagnant. Investors looking for to maximise returns could even view properties in these regions as liabilities quite than alternatives.

Government intervention by way of subsidies or low-interest loans to aid restoration can temporarily buoy property values. However, this assist is often fleeting. Once the assistance stops, property values may plummet once more, especially if the community does not implement long-term flood mitigation measures.


The psychological impact of flooding cannot be underestimated in relation to property values. Beyond bodily damage, the emotional toll on homeowners—stemming from loss, fear, or anxiety—can affect their willingness to spend cash on properties in flood-prone areas. This emotional response can influence market conduct, resulting in an ongoing cycle of devaluation.
